What is One Joke a Day?

One Joke a Day is an entertainment app that delivers a single, hand-picked joke via daily push notifications on iOS and Android.

Users hire the app to establish a low-friction morning humor habit, but the lack of an archive or social loop forces them to look elsewhere for sustained engagement.

What Are The Key Features?

Daily Joke DeliveryStandard

Push notification system triggers a fresh, non-repeating joke every morning

User Feedback LoopStandard

In-app mechanism allows users to rate individual jokes

Multi-language SupportDifferentiator

Content localized into five languages: English, French, Spanish, Hindi, and Arabic

What are the next best moves?

highInvest

Ship a favorites archive because the current daily-only model lacks long-term retention utility → increase daily session time

Competitors like Daily Dad Jokes! use favorites libraries to retain users, while the target lacks this feature.

Trade-off: Pause the expansion of the language library — the current five languages cover the primary addressable market.

mediumPivot

Audit iOS UI/UX because the 3.5-star rating significantly lags the 4.46 Android baseline → stabilize iOS rating

The rating gap between platforms indicates specific friction points in the iOS build.

Trade-off: Deprioritize new joke category additions — current content volume is sufficient for the existing user base.
